Setup and Monthly Fee

A one timetime setup fee is calculated based on the number of individual products in your catalog. This covers the setup of your inventory in our system as well the setup of you dedicated Pick-and-Pack racks.

A monthly account maintenance fee is calculated based on your order volume, the number of individual produts and the average number of items in an order.

Order Fulfillment

Our typical fulfillment fees for an ongoing business are as follows*:

  • Frozen / Refrigerated Products: $7.00 per order + $.60 per item + UPS, DHL or USPS charges.

this includes a styrofoam cooler and the necessary dry ice or ice packs to keep the products at the proper temperature for the duration of shipping.

  • Dry Products: $2.00 per order + $.30 per item + UPS, DHL or USPS charges.

this includes a standard shipping box and filling materials necessary for a safe shipping.

*These are average, indicative conditions and pricing may vary depending onthe number of SKUs, the size of your average order, the number of orders shipped per month etc. If you ship more than 500 orders a month, you may be elligible for additional discounts but if you ship less than 200 orders a month your base cost will likely be higher. Inventory Storage

  • Frozen / Refrigerated Products: $40 per month, including 1 4'x4'x4' pallet, plus $25.00 per additional single-sku pallet or $40 per mixed pallet.
  • Dry Products: $20 per month per pallet.
